The control board will likely be on the floor of the unit under the galley.
To install a switch to disconnect power, you simply need to splice in to the 12V feed that goes to the small 2 pin connector on the control board, run your power to the switch and then the switch leg back to the positive side of that 2 pin connector.
Zip dee does have a control switch that has your awning controls and an on/off switch on it.
